Декларация по НДС в электронном виде

Автор Сообщение
aav
Администратор
Администратор

Зарегистрирован: 14.09.2004
Сообщения: 1081
Откуда: Санкт-Петербург

Добавлено: 26.03.2015 09:34 Заголовок сообщения: Декларация по НДС в электронном виде
Коллеги, здравствуйте,

Наступает новая жизнь. Всех, кто сдаёт декларации по НДС, обязуют это делать в электронном виде.

Эпикор заблаговременно подготовился к этому событию и предлагает своё решение: http://www.scala-info.ru/2015/02/166/

А я недавно говорил с клиентом SAP, для которого актуальна та же задача. Ведь это абсолютно безразлично, откуда отчет появился в Excel’е — из iScala с помощью RGW или из другой системы, неважно с помощью какого инструмента. Кроме этого этот клиент в разговоре со мной сказал, что у них книги покупок и продаж могут содержать до 600 тысяч записей. Задачка показалась мне интересной и я решил "накопировать" много строк и посмотреть, возможно ли их обработать в таком количестве. Для повышения быстродействия и для того, чтобы пользователи, у которых нет RGW получили какую-то альтернативу, я решил сделать немного иначе: сначала закачать данные из отчёта из Excel в таблицу SQL, а уже из SQL таблицы запросом преобразовать их в XML файл.

Исходные данные отчета — 300 000 строк. Результаты обработки: Закачка в SQL таблицу — чуть менее 4 минут, создание XML файла — 1 минута 54 секунды, загрузка в программу "Налогоплательщик ЮЛ" — 35 минут.

Хотите узнать большие подробности? Пишите!

aav
Администратор
Администратор

Зарегистрирован: 14.09.2004
Сообщения: 1081
Откуда: Санкт-Петербург

Добавлено: 26.03.2015 18:12 Заголовок сообщения: Re: Декларация по НДС в электронном виде

aav писал(а):
Наступает новая жизнь. Всех, кто сдаёт декларации по НДС, обязуют это делать в электронном виде.

Кстати, забыл спросить: А как эту задачу собираются решать (или уже решили) в вашей компании?

Владимир
Форумщик

Зарегистрирован: 08.07.2009
Сообщения: 5
Откуда: MOSCOW

Добавлено: 30.03.2015 07:56 Заголовок сообщения: Re: Декларация по НДС в электронном виде
Сами написали. Что то подобное вашему решению.
Владимир
Форумщик

Зарегистрирован: 08.07.2009
Сообщения: 5
Откуда: MOSCOW

Добавлено: 20.04.2015 10:39 Заголовок сообщения: Re: Декларация по НДС в электронном виде
PS: а как у вас реализована такая быстрая загрузка 300к строк в базу?
aav
Администратор
Администратор

Зарегистрирован: 14.09.2004
Сообщения: 1081
Откуда: Санкт-Петербург

Добавлено: 20.04.2015 12:24 Заголовок сообщения: Re: Декларация по НДС в электронном виде
Сам удивляюсь Very Happy

Владимир
Форумщик

Зарегистрирован: 08.07.2009
Сообщения: 5
Откуда: MOSCOW

Добавлено: 20.04.2015 14:01 Заголовок сообщения:
видимо внутри екселя это работает побыстрее чем через COM. У меня из VB 150К строк почти час затягивается
Jugulator
Главный форумщик

Зарегистрирован: 08.10.2004
Сообщения: 428

Добавлено: 28.04.2015 16:14 Заголовок сообщения: Функция ExportRangeToSQL
Функция VBA ExportRangeToSQL позволяет записывать данные из Microsoft Excel 2003/2007/2010/2013 в таблицу SQL Server. Не требует указания ссылки на ActiveX Data Objects 2.x Library.